Understanding the Game Mechanics
At its core, the chicken road game is a game of chance, but strategic thinking can significantly improve a player’s odds of success. The game features a chicken progressing across multiple lanes (typically ranging from 15 to 25), with each successful step increasing the multiplier associated with the current round. Players must decide when to cash out their bet, securing their winnings before the chicken crashes. The timing is crucial, as cashing out too early means missing out on a potentially larger payout, while waiting too long risks losing the entire stake. The game offers different difficulty levels, impacting both the number of lanes and the associated risk, as detailed further below. Successful gameplay emphasizes quick decision-making and a good understanding of probability.

Volatility and RTP
The Return to Player (RTP) is a critical metric when assessing the fairness of any casino game. The chicken road game typically boasts a high RTP of 98%, indicating a favorable return for players over the long term. However, it’s important to remember that the game’s volatility is also relatively high. This means that while the average payout is substantial, individual results can vary considerably. Players might experience prolonged losing streaks, interspersed with occasional significant wins. Managing bankroll effectively and understanding the inherent risk are crucial for mitigating potential losses. The higher volatility adds to the excitement, attracting those seeking larger potential payouts, though it’s essential to gamble responsibly.
Betting Range and Maximum Wins
The appeal of the chicken road game is further enhanced by its flexible betting range. Typically, players can wager as little as £0.01, making it accessible to those with limited budgets, while the maximum bet can reach up to £162. This wide range caters to various playing styles and risk appetites. The maximum win potential is also substantial, especially on the more challenging levels. On Hard or Hardcore mode, players can potentially win up to £16,200 with a 100x multiplier. Managing Your Bankroll
Effective bankroll management is paramount in any casino game, and the chicken road game is no exception. Establishing a budget before you start playing and sticking to it is essential. Avoid chasing losses, as this can quickly deplete your funds. A general guideline is to wager only a small percentage of your bankroll on each bet, typically between 1% and 5%. This helps to preserve your funds and extend your playing time. Furthermore, setting win limits can help you lock in profits and prevent you from giving back your winnings.
